#e16801 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e16801 is composed of 88.2% red, 40.8%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 53.8% magenta, 99.6%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 27.6 degrees, a saturation of 99.1% and a lightness of 44.3%. #e16801 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d002 with #c30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

#e16801 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e16801 has RGB values of R:225, G:104, B:1 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.54, Y:1, K:0.12. Its decimal value is 14772225.
